It's been a while since I refreshed the binutils opcodes files that
are cgen generated. On doing so it appears this patch is responsible
for build errors when using mainline gcc. First example:
/home/alan/src/binutils-gdb/opcodes/bpf-opc.c:57:11: error: conversion from ‘long unsigned int’ to ‘unsigned int’ changes value from ‘18446744073709486335’ to ‘4294902015’ [-Werror=overflow]
57 | 64, 64, 0xffffffffffff00ff, { { F (F_IMM32) }, { F (F_OFFSET16) }, { F (F_SRCLE) }, { F (F_OP_CODE) }, { F (F_DSTLE) }, { F (F_OP_SRC) }, { F (F_OP_CLASS) }, { 0 } }
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
I tested an obvious workaround,
diff --git a/include/opcode/cgen.h b/include/opcode/cgen.h
index 8b7d2a4b547..0e9571d19b0 100644
--- a/include/opcode/cgen.h
+++ b/include/opcode/cgen.h
@@ -914,7 +914,7 @@ typedef struct
Each insn's value is stored with the insn.
The first step in recognizing an insn for disassembly is
(opcode & mask) == value. */
- CGEN_INSN_INT mask;
+ uint64_t mask;
#define CGEN_IFMT_MASK(ifmt) ((ifmt)->mask)
/* Instruction fields.
diff --git a/opcodes/cgen-dis.c b/opcodes/cgen-dis.c
index 1a5d1ae8459..37ee5a23564 100644
--- a/opcodes/cgen-dis.c
+++ b/opcodes/cgen-dis.c
@@ -39,7 +39,7 @@ static void add_insn_to_hash_chain (CGEN_INSN_LIST *,
static int
count_decodable_bits (const CGEN_INSN *insn)
{
- unsigned mask = CGEN_INSN_BASE_MASK (insn);
+ uint64_t mask = CGEN_INSN_BASE_MASK (insn);
#if GCC_VERSION >= 3004
return __builtin_popcount (mask);
#else
Quite possibly the above isn't a complete fix, I just threw it
together to see what happens. Regressions:
